Body
Origins and Family
Recorded date of birth include +1936-04-29T00:00:00Z[2] and +1936-00-00T00:00:00Z[4]. Lee Jong-chan's father was Lee Gyuhak[5]. His mother was Jo Gyejin[6]. Korean was his native language[9].
Education
Lee Jong-chan's education included a stint at Korea Military Academy[16].
Career and Affiliations
Lee Jong-chan worked as a politician[3]. Among his employers was Hanyang University[15]. Positions held include Member of the National Assembly of South Korea[10], an elective office[27], in South Korea[28].
Personal Life
A child of Lee Jong-chan was Chulwoo Lee[7].
